Eligibility & Rules

The UK Educators Community Business Awards recognise the best in the education industry in the UK. Please note the following rules for eligibility of awards.

  1. Nominee’s and their businesses must be based in the UK. They may operate globally but their registered business address must be in the UK.
  2. Educators must be active in the past 12 months. The nominations must focus on the achievements over the last 12 months in particular
  3. Award Sponsors are not eligible to be nominated for awards they are asponsoring. They can be nominated for other award categories.
  4. Lead / partnership sponsors are not eligible for nominations.
  5. Syd and her associated businesses, UK Educators Communuty, Femtinos & UK Virtual School are not eligible for nominations.

Rules

  • The deadline for receiving entries is final and any nominations received after the deadline will not be considered
  • Businesses / Educators may nominate for as many categories they see fit
  • Finalists are selected based on the quality of their submission and at the discretion of UK Educators Community
  • Judges decision is final and no correspondence will be entered into.
  • Winners will be contacted personally and awards posted out within a few weeks of the awards evening
  • Winners will be introduced to th award sponsor for their category for the coaching / mentoring offer. UK Educators Community is not responsible for the delivery of these sessions beyond making the first introduction.

Inspiring STEM Educator of the Year 2021 – sponsored by Georgina Green, Green Tutors

This award recognises the outreach work and commitment from a STEM Educator in any of the STEM subjects, Science, Technology, Engineering or Mathematics. The individual must demonstrate how they have inspired young people, especially those under-represented in the STEM fields, into developing a love for STEM subjects

Agency of the Year 2021 – sponsored by Jemma Smith, Education Hotel

The Agency award recognises agencies who are committed to high quality education, CPD of tutors and show good levels of Tutor retention through building meaningful relationships. This award is open to new agencies as well as established.
